cat /proc/mdstat #listet den aktuellen Status aller bekannten Raid-Devises mdadm --detail --scan /dev/mdX #zeigt detailierte informationen eines Raid-Arrays mdadm --examine /dev/sdX #scannt bei einem beliebigen device nach Raid-MetaInformationen mdadm --assemble /dev/mdX /dev/sdX [/dev/sdY] ... [--force] #Startet ein Raid-Array --force auch wenn es degraded ist mdadm --stop /dev/mdX #stop ein Raid-Array (wird benötigt um die Metadaten zu löschen!) mdadm --manage /dev/mdX -a /dev/sdX #fügt eine neue Platte einem Array hinzu (Platte wird als spare genutzt) mdadm --manage /dev/mdX -f /dev/sdX #markiert eine Platte als "fehlerhaft" mdadm --manage /dev/mdX -r /dev/sdX #entfernt eine disk aus einem Array mdadm --manage /dev/mdX -r detached #entfernt alle nicht mehr vorhandenen Disks aus einem Array raus. mdadm --grow /dev/md/mdX --raid-devices n #nutze n-Platten für den raid (gibt Spares frei oder nutz Spares für den Raid) mdadm --zero-superblock /dev/sdX #entfernt alle Metainformationen von einer Disk
Schlagwort: mdadm
Software-RAID beim boot aktivieren
Wer das erste mal mit mdadm einen Software-RAID erstellt wird feststellen, dass dieser nach dem reboot nicht unbedingt sofort am start ist oder gar erst über Klimmzüge zum laufen zu bekommen ist. Abhilfe bringt folgender Befehl:
mdadm --detail --scan > /etc/mdadm/mdadm.conf
Aktuallisierung der munin raid skripte
Da ich nun auf reine Software-Raids umgestiegen bin (von Fake-Raides) habe ich meine munin-skripte entsprechend erweitert.
Download hier: raid_status